Power off the break
Find Neutral Wires at the live side.

The master switch must be installed at the live side in the 3-way circuit. (Find correct wires)Make sure there are neutral wires for the master switch. If not, the switches cannot work properly. Neutral wires are white and NOT used by your old switch. Connect wires according the marks on the switch.

Tips:

  • Wires on your old non-smart 3-way switches are:1st Switch: Live, TRA1, TRA22nd Switch: Load, TRA1, TRA2
  • TRA-1 & TRA-2 is very easy to identify. Generally 1red, 1black. They come from the same wire jacket.
  • Neutral wires are not used by your old switch and capped in the outlet box.

Recommended Connection procedures

  1. Connect Ground Wire (Copper or Green. This is not necessary)
  2. Connect Neutral Wire (White, not on old switch. This is necessary for Wi-Fi switch)
  3. Connect Live Wire (Black, hot wire on old switch)
  4. Turn on the breaker, and the indicator on the switch will light up. If not, send us a photo of the wiring
  5.  Turn of the breaker
  6. Connect TRA-1 & TRA-2 (Two wires to your traditional switch)
FQA:

1. How can I know it is connected correctly?A: Press the on/off button, dim button on both Master and Add-On switch. They should work properly. Indicator lights on the Master Switch can show the brightness of light bulbs.

4. How can I find which one is the live (hot) line, neutral wire?A: Besides the ground wire, there are three wires on your old switch in general:

  • 1 black & 1 red wire from the same location, they are TRA-1 & TRA-2;
  • 1 black wire from another location, it is live or load. You can use a tester to test it.
